Is it legal for Daniel S. Goldman to trade Molson Coors Brewing Co Class B (TAP) stock?

Yes. Members of Congress are allowed to trade individual stocks, including Molson Coors Brewing Co Class B (TAP), but the STOCK Act of 2012 requires them to publicly disclose each transaction within 45 days. Quantellect tracks those disclosures; this page does not imply the trade was improper.

How soon must members of Congress disclose a trade?

Under the STOCK Act, members of Congress must publicly report a covered transaction within 45 days of the trade. Filings can still be delayed, amended, or contain errors.
